Delhi police arrest foreign ministry driver for espionage

Pakistan ISI honey-trapped him, according to sources

New Delhi, Nov 18: A driver employed at the Ministry of External Affairs was arrested today from Jawahar Lal Nehru Bhawan in New Delhi on espionage charges. He was allegedly transferring information and documents in exchange for money to a Pakistani person who was pretending to be a woman named Poonam Sharma or Pooja.

Sources in the crime branch of Delhi Police, which made the arrest, said the driver was honey-trapped.
